Slow virus co-transfection adherent 293T cell device for large-scale cell therapy
A cell therapy and lentivirus technology, applied in tissue cell/virus culture devices, biochemical cleaning devices, enzymology/microbiology devices, etc., can solve the problem of inconvenient removal of cultured cells, unfavorable large-scale culture, and unfavorable cell growth. and other problems, to achieve the effect that is conducive to large-scale culture, meets cell growth conditions, and has a scientific and reasonable structure
